Kate Moss by Rimmel lipstick (Shade 26) £5.49 from Boots

I was always a bit iffy about nude lipstick- done wrong they can definitely have a distinct 'concealer lips' appearance which lets face it, isn't flattering anyone. But over the last few weeks I've been picking up a few nude shades here and there and I have to say I really like them, I think as long as the rest of your makeup is quite heavy to balance them out it can look really nice.

I'm already a huge fan of the Kate by Rimmel lipsticks so when I spotted this one I was eager to give it a go. It's quite a warm toned nude which is a bit of a risky choice with my cool toned skin, but I've discovered that it's a nice one for when I've been fake tanning. I like the fact that it's not too light and 'concealer-y' and doesn't look like I'm wearing brown lipstick either (another risk factor when it comes to finding the perfect nude lipstick!) It's a nice mid shade that gives colour and definition to the lips while still remaining in the nude lip category.

As with all the Kate lipsticks this is creamy and applies beautifully, it's slightly less velvety in texture than the matte collection and the finish is a bit more glossy. The wear time is about average, but it's not so slippery that it's smearing all over your face within five minutes so a nice easy wearing product. I think this has taken the top spot for my favourite nude lipstick, and has pipped by current most worn nudes Mac's 'Hue' and Dainty Doll's 'Baby Love' to the post.
